      I apologize if this has been asked and answered already, I didn't find the answer in my search. I recently purchased and received a SG-1100 as my first pfSense appliance ever and so far not too bad, but I see mention of a telegraf package and since I have all my other stuff going into Grafana, I figured why not also have this go there and save the disk space on the little SG-1100. Problem is, I don't see a telegraf package available and can't find good instructions on how to manually add it to 2.4.4.
      Thanks in advance

        Unfortunately one of the dependencies doesn't compile on that platform on our build infrastructure at the moment. That may change in the future, and when it does, we'll enable the package then.
